Captain James Cook is an English explorer who discovered the Hawaiian Islands on January 18, 1778. He discovered Hawaiian islands when he sailed past the island of Oahu. He landed on the island of Kauai and called the group of island, Sandwich Islands.

Neville Chamberlain believed that the Munich Agreement had brought peace in Europe and thus supported it. On the other hand, Winston Churchill strongly opposed it.

More about Munich Agreement:

On September 30, 1938, Germany, the United Kingdom, France, and Italy reached an agreement in Munich. Despite a 1924 alliance agreement and a 1925 military treaty between France and the Czechoslovak Republic, it gave "cession to Germany of the Sudeten German area," for which it is also known as the Munich Betrayal.

The Munich Agreement is now largely viewed as a futile attempt at appeasement, and the phrase "a byword for the failure of appeasing expansionist totalitarian governments" has been used to describe it.
